Syncing playlists to iPod and losing all existing playlists and music

I tried to sync a playlist to my iPod, not only did it not put the new playlist on, it deleted all the other playlists I had on my iPod and most of the songs I had. What causes that and how do I fix it?

At a guess, either:

  1. you are managing your iPod by using Sync selected playlists, artists, albums and genres and you have changed the selection of music to be synchronised, or
  2. you have synchronised the iPod to a different iTunes Library


iPods can only be synchronised with one library; If you try to sync with another iTunes Library, you would see a message telling you that all existing music would be removed from the iPod if you Sync with this iTunes.


To remedy to fix it depends on what you did to cause it. If you let us know we can advise you further.
